Lopez is 5'10" and 165 pounds, and is the #252 overall recruit (composite). Spafford is 5'11" and 175 pounds, and is the #74 overall recruit (composite). And Spafford is faster. We've been looking for HEIGHT and speed at WR almost exclusively. If we are going to make ONE EXCEPTION and dip below 6' for a WR, we are not going to take two guys who are in the same range. And we didn't know we would get Spafford. I'm not saying the staff wasn't a big fan of Lopez at one time, but we aren't taking 7 WRs. Spafford committed and fit the bill, all our other remaining targets are taller. That's a fact.

This is about locking up nearly the entire blue-chip Class of 2026 before the House settlement becomes formalized NCAA law. This is everyone's last chance to sign a big "Collective NIL" deal before all the fascist Wisconsin-FSU language gets inserted into all the rev-share deals. THAT is why you won't see much flipping after August, because it's pretty hard to give up a bird in the hand for even less in the House bush. Not because it's "so hard in this day and age".
